Line s has an equation of y = x - 10. Line t is parallel to line s and passes through
(-1,-3). What is the equation of line t?

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

y = x - 10. the slope here is 1. A parallel line will have the same slope.

y = mx + b

slope(m) = 1

(-1,-3).....x = -1 and y = -3

now sub and find b, the y intercept

-3 = 1(-1) + b

-3 = -1 + b

-3 + 1 = b

-2 = b

so ur equation is : y = x - 2 <=== equation for line t
